    Cookie time
    Taylor J.

    I love spontaneously finding a great dessert place! And lets be honest, it will always be cookie time in my wold, so i was super happy when we stumbled upon Chip cookies. Walked in around 1pm and it was quiet in the cute little cookie shop. We were greeted by the lovely server at the front who gave us a run down since it was the first time in this place. They have their go-to cookies they can prepare for you or you can make your own creation with options they have on the ready. We opted for a few of their signature cookies: Chocolate chip Tres Leches Biscoff Another chocolate one i forgot the name of All were great, rich, and filling! Since we got a pack of 4 cookies, we were able to get a cup of coffee gratis with our order. It was a beautiful day so it was nice to sit outside out front of the place, sip on some coffee, and enjoy a cookie. I love a little spot like this, such a cute touch to the area.

    Thick cookie
    Fara A.

    Small store located in the large Ralph's shopping area. Cookies are large, perfect amount of crisp on the outside, and soft inside. Thick and quite substantial. And most importantly, not too sweet. If you want sweet, you can add frosting or toppings but I skipped right by these. I love that they have a "boneless" cookie. It's described as a butter cookie but it tasted like a chocolate chip cookie without the chocolate chips! Sometimes, the dough is all you want. ;) $5 each, came up to a little over $11 for two. I dare say these are better than Levain!

    Boneless, Choco, og, sea salt chocolate chip
    Ashley B.

    Whenever I'm in an area I don't go to very often, I check Yelp for any good bakeries or dessert spots. So I decided to pop in here at about 9:00 p.m. on a Friday and was pleasantly surprised to see that all their flavors were available. The staff here is super friendly and explained how everything works. You can get plain cookies, already topped and decorated cookies, or add toppings of your choosing to cookies. I opted for just plain naked cookies because I'm not a big fan of frosting and I really just wanted to try the cookies themselves. They're puffy in the middle because some of them have filling but they're cooked to perfection. A little crispy on the outside and soft but not undercooked on the inside. They were the perfect level of sweetness and I'd say the salted chocolate chip was the best, but they were all great. My husband said it was probably some of the best cookies he's ever eaten. My only complaint is that there isn't a location closer to us! Please come to the San Fernando valley, Chip!

    Ambiance: it's a spacious cookie shop, they have the counter to customize cookies and the racks to keep cookies warm Service: friendly staff and patient with questions Food: standard choices or you can add your own toppings Raspberry Cookie - *** based on butter cookie, good combination of acidity from the raspberry chips and sweetness from the wet cookie dough Price: each cookie costs about $6, and the 4-pack price is roughly three cookies price for four pieces, which is a better deal but still relatively overpriced
